HTML

Programozó Páternoszter

Ez a Programozó Páternoszter (PP) blogja, a programozásról szól. Aktualitása, hogy a Debreceni Egyetem Informatikai Kara Magasszintű programozási nyelvek 1-2, C++ esattanulmányok, Java esettanulmányok című kurzusainak blogja is egyben.

A vadászat

A Debreceni Egyetem Programozói Évkönyve: az UDPROG projekt. A szakmai fórumunk a Facebook-en. Az új előadások a prezin.
A régi előadások:
Prog1:
1. C bevezetés
2. C tárgyalás
3. C befejezés
4. C a gyakorlatban
5. C++ bevezetés
6. C++ tárgyalás
7. C++ befejezés
8. C++ a gyakorlatban
9. Java platform bevezetés
10. Kvantuminformatikai alg. bev.
Prog2:
1. Java bevezetés
2. Java tárgyalás
3. Java befejezés
4. Java a gyakorlatban
5. Software Engineering bev.
6. Java EE bevezetés
7. AspectJ bevezetés
8. BPMN-BPEL SOA programozás
9. C++ haladó
10. Tensorflow

Kövess engem!

Friss topikok

Linkblog

Web 2 diákok Web 2 tanárok

2011.03.07. 10:50 nb

A közelgő IF 2011 konfihoz (és ezt követően egy angol nyelvű kézirat elkészítéséhez) keresek érdeklődő társszerzőket a

"Webkettes diákok és webkettes tanárok"

munkacímű legjobb gyakorlat kialakításához. Persze az idő már kevés egy teljes kurzus blog-YouTube-Twitter-Tumblr-Facebook-iwiw- "esítéséhez", de a Programozás 1 kapcsán azt tudom felajánlani és egyben várni a csatlakozótól, hogy például egy-két http://progpater.blog.hu/ vendégposszttal vegyen részt a munkában az alábbi (vagy javasolt más új) irányokban

  • ráépülő tárgy mit vár el (pl. egy ráépülő bevezető példa kidolgozása)
  • matematikai háttérnél alkalmazás (pl. most a PR algoritmusnál csak halvány utalás van arra, hogy az 1 értékhez tartozó sajátvektort keressük)
  • párhuzamosan futó tárgy átvesz/áthangol PP http://progpater.blog.hu/ példát

A kurzus aktuális hallgatóinak csatlakozását is támogatom az alábbi használati esetek mentén

  • tutor jelleggel hogyan segítettem diáktársaimat az anyagban
  • a kurzus példáira, azokból kiindulva vagy csak ihletve milyen saját ráépülő programokat fejlesztettem

Szólj hozzá!

Címkék: informatika a felsőoktatásban

Hálózati vegyérték

2011.03.06. 19:00 nb

Ha a képzési hálóban a tárgyak kovalens kötéssel kapcsolódnának, akkor a ráépülő Hálózatok tárgy felé az alábbi példa feldolgozásával kötünk majd. Ez egy egyszerű hálózati TCP/IP szerverprogi, amit próbáltunk állatorvosi módon elkészíteni, mert lesz benne:

  • fork
  • socket programozás (UNIX-ban minden fájl)
  • multiplexelés (a select rendszerhívás)
  • jelkezelés
  • szemaforok
  • osztott memória használata

 A program első iniciális változatának összedobása után lássuk a tesztelést:

Eddig ez kíméletes volt, de laborkísérletezzünk vele: a kliens nyomja párhuzamosabban, vegyük ki/be a szemaforos védelmet a szerveren és tegyünk be egy kis alvós késleltetést a kiszolgálásba! Miket tapasztalunk? Egy trófea annak, aki demonstrálja, hogy elromlik az örök válasz: a 42.

Lapozz tovább a forrásokért:

Szólj hozzá!

Címkék: select fork socket szemafor osztott memória multiplexelés

süti beállítások módosítása